AWWTM: What is a bicyclist?


A good review of a medical intervention starts by explaining the population being studied.  The Cochrane review of helmets for preventing head injuries in bicyclists explains that its population is the set of bicyclists who sustained an injury that was sufficiently major to make them go to the ER for treatment (and not sufficient to kill them before they could seek treatment).
